#41593a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#41593a is composed of 25.5% red, 34.9%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 106.5 degrees, a saturation of 21.1% and a lightness of 28.8%. #41593a color hex could be obtained by blending #82b274 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#41593a color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#41593a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#41593a has RGB values of R:65, G:89,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4282682.

Shades and Tints of #41593a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040604 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#41593a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474e45 is the less saturated color, while #229201 is the most saturated one.
